POSITION SUMMARY:

We are seeking an experienced Data Architect and Team Lead to join our BI and Reporting team. The successful candidate will be responsible for collaborating with our business analysts and stakeholders as well as leading the team of BI developers to design, develop, and implement innovative business intelligence solutions.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ead a team of BI engineers in the design, development and deployment of our Azure data lake based BI Solution.
  • Define vision, strategy, and principles for data management in collaboration with senior executives to support the company’s business strategies and priorities.
  • Act as an evangelist for a bigger picture strategy, integrating the business and technological vision, connecting the dots across business needs, technologies, processes, and information.
  • Manage team by performing performance evaluations, development and growth plans, appraisals, and remediation as needed.
  • Work with business analysts to understand requirements and translate them into technical specifications.
  • Develop and maintain documentation of data models, data flows, and data mappings.
  • Propose and run/govern proof of concepts for new technologies which could result in differentiating capabilities for the business.
  • Ensure data quality and data governance standards are met across the data platform.
  • Review Data Warehouse business cases and initiatives to identify, assess, and communicate feasibility, architecture requirements, costs, and issues. In general, provide thought leadership to evolving business intelligence (BI) activities.
  • Develop, implement, measure, and continuously improve workflow processes.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Experience and Training:

  • Bachelor’s or master’s degree in computer science, information technology,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 8 years of experience in BI development, data modeling, and data integration.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in using cloud-based technologies to design and implement enterprise level BI solutions.
  • Excellent communication skills, including the ability to communicate technical information to non-technical stakeholders.
  • Experience in leading and managing teams of BI engineers.
  • Strong understanding of data warehousing concepts, data modeling techniques, and ETL processes.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ills
  • Experience with cloud-based data platforms, such as A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ud.
  • Strong proficiency in SQL and at least one programming language (Python, Java, Scala).
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Azure data management and business intelligence stack including Azure Data Factory, Azure Data Lake (Gen 2), Databricks, Azure Analysis Services, Azure SQL Database, and Power BI.
